The Parker O-Ring Selector. Fully integrated material and size selection Platform-independent and web-based Easy. This search and filter function searches a database of more than 2, different materials.
In the Hardware Configuration , you can choose between different sealing cases such as radial piston or rod sealing, axial sealing with internal or external pressure.. After selecting a material that fits your sealing application, you can continue by having the Size Selector calculate the O-ring dimensions and tolerances, considering even thermal expansion and volume swelling of the sealing element. The parameter dashboard in the Results section will immediately show you if the selected O-ring size is suitable for your application.
Add your comments in the Notes section and save your calculation to your computer as a PDF document.
